Sotatercept might help treat portopulmonary hypertension

Patients with portopulmonary hypertension were not included in clinical trials for sotatercept. This case report found that sotatercept helped one patient with portopulmonary hypertension, who was then able to get a liver transplant. However, they did note some risks.
